是的,Java可以在运行中动态加载类。Java提供了三种动态加载类的机制:

  1. 'Class.forName()':通过指定类的全限定名加载类,返回Class对象。

  2. 'ClassLoader.loadClass()':通过ClassLoader加载类,返回Class对象。

  3. 自定义ClassLoader:自定义ClassLoader可以实现更加灵活的类加载机制,例如从网络或者数据库中加载类。


原文地址: https://www.cveoy.top/t/topic/ozTm 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录